The Appraisal/Revalidation and Job Planning Co-ordinator will manage and oversee the work of the Appraisal, Revalidation and Job Planning Team reporting to the Associate Medical Director and Appraisal Lead to manage the appraisal system for all doctors in non- training posts within the Trust, and support the process of medical revalidation in line with GMC requirements, including coordinating the patient and colleague feedback.
This role combines provision of a detailed and customer focussed administrative service with strong technical support across a variety of systems used to support Revalidation and Job Planning processes at the trust.
It will focus on managing and developing processes for consultant job planning with the Trust, supporting the Chiefs of Service, Specialty Directors and the Consultant and SAS Doctor body to ensure that the directorates are supported to deliver this in line with Trust policy and national standards of best practice.
The post holder is expected manage a team handling highly sensitive and complex information pertaining to a large group of senior staff within the organisation.
They will be expected to establish and maintain relationships internally and externally in order to assist in the management of appraisal, revalidation and job planning.
In addition, they will be expected to be able to persuade and influence senior medical staff to ensure that these processes are positively promoted and implemented within the organisation.
